Stuttgarter Kinderstiftung
About the funder
The Stuttgarter Kinderstiftung is a non-profit trust foundation under the umbrella of the Bürgerstiftung Stuttgart. Since its founding, it has been committed to providing disadvantaged children and adolescents in the state capital Stuttgart with fair starting conditions and sustainable development opportunities. With a focus on education, health, culture, and physical activity, it supports local projects, organizes charity runs, and long-term initiatives to improve participation and equal opportunities.

Mission & Vision
Growing up strong in Stuttgart – that is our mission. We aim to empower children who need support and create equal opportunities for all children, regardless of their background or social status. Education, music, physical activity, and culture should be accessible to every child. Together with partners from politics, business, and civil society, we promote projects that achieve sustainable impact and make children's rights more visible.
Target groups
The funding programs of the Stuttgarter Kinderstiftung are aimed at children and adolescents in Stuttgart who grow up in challenging life circumstances. This includes, in particular, children from financially disadvantaged families, with a migration background, or with special support needs. Our offerings support schools, daycare centers, clubs, and initiatives that implement projects for early development, health prevention, cultural participation, and the strengthening of children's rights.
